    DanaNM replied to the topic Regression in litterbox training: we're desperate in the forum BEHAVIOR 4 years, 4 months ago

    How long have they been bonded? Sometimes it takes a few weeks for litter box habits to return after bonding, and some people even notice an uptick in marking right after they are bonded. Marking around the perimeter of the enclosure does sound territorial.
